Transaction 81cbb7c40247257e618e1f5c0ba8a932fb093a02bf1580131033875449a9763e
1 Input
1 Output
-
81cbb7c40247257e618e1f5c0ba8a932fb093a02bf1580131033875449a9763e:0
- value
- 21663105
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a8abdaefd376eb1820b4452fa0bed9144eef331 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19Fk29zYiuwBnY3GDXPhZwbLsqHPuJqx3F